ToeTag is an open-source incident response and digital forensics tool for gathering system information and analyzing log files. It assists with intrusion detection, data recovery, and analysis of security incidents.
Puddletag is an open-source tag editor for audio files. It allows users to easily view and edit ID3 tags in MP3, Ogg Vorbis, FLAC, Musepack, WavPack, Speex, AIFF, and WMA files. Some key features include batch editing tags, integrated audio player, cover art support, and advanced tag editing tools.
